    At about 65 USD (ie 60 euros) are you sure it was the M200 and not the P200 ? (one's a piston filler (M), the other is a cartridge version(P)).
    Nope, not sure at all... Will check before purhase,thank you for bringing this to my attention
    Check on Amazon.de, there are often M200's around €60 or just above. The piston version (M) is called "Kolbenfüller", the P is "Patronenfüller".

    Quote Originally Posted by Jeph View Post
    I expect the nib unit collar was cracked.
    Think about the same. Last time i need to order a replacement from Custompenparts for my 140 after lend it to a friend. Don't know what he did to it, luckily the nib is till in perfect shape, so i think he didn't drop it.

    BTW, you could sometime get a used M200 or M150 at ~$30-40, but it will need ton of luck. I did win a bid at $32 for a used black M200, have some heavy cosmetic tear and wear, but the nib and pistol are just perfect. And i also won another bid for a new M205 solid red at 42 Euro from Martini Auctions.
